The HelioScope Moat
Choose HelioScope over generic residential AI tools if your business relies on bankable C&I simulations and institutional financing. While AI drafting is faster for simple roofs, HelioScope’s physics-based engine provides the P90/P95 fidelity required for large-scale C&I and ground-mount debt facility approval.
The SenseHawk Moat
SenseHawk is the 'Asset Digitization Leader' because it solves the 'Portfolio Visibility' problem for GWh-scale portfolios. Now a Nextracker company, it is the only platform providing a unified digital twin from site selection to long-term O&M. By integrating high-resolution thermal drone data with industrial SCADA feeds, SenseHawk allows Stage 4 operators to identify panel-level defects across massive utility sites and reduce MTTR (Mean Time To Repair) by over 60%.

Pricing: Basic ($159/mo), Pro ($259/mo)
Key Features
- NREL-validated Shading Accuracy
- Bifacial Module & P90/P95/P99 Modeling
- Direct API & PVsyst Export
- Single-Axis Tracker Support
- Automated Single-Line Diagrams (Enterprise)
- LIDAR-assisted Obstruction Detection
Pros
- Massive scale capacity (up to 30MW on Enterprise)
- Simulations align within 1% of PVsyst results
- Superior for commercial ground-mount and trackers
Cons
- Rigid 10-project/month limit on the Basic monthly plan
- Drawing tools have a higher learning curve than residential AI tools
- Basic plan design capacity capped at 1.25MW
